8.04.060 Collection--Quarterly fees and liens.

The collection and disposal fees shall be payable quarterly in advance. The beginning dates of all quarterly periods shall be determined by the city treasurer. In the event the owner, occupant, or lessee of any tract of real property shall fail or refuse to pay the fees imposed by Chapter 8.04 within thirty days of the billing date, then and in that event the city manager shall cause a notice concerning such failure or refusal to be prepared on a form satisfactory to him. Such notice shall be served by delivery or by mailing to the owner, occupant, or lessee of the tract of real property involved, or in the event the whereabouts of such owner, occupant or lessee cannot be ascertained, by posting notice in a prominent place upon the tract of real property involved. In the event the owner, occupant or lessee of the tract described in the notice shall fail to pay all fees then due, within five days after the delivery, mailing or posting of such notice, then and in that event, the city clerk shall, within six months thereafter, prepare a claim of lien against the tract of real property involved, in such form as may be satisfactory to him, and shall file such claim of lien as an encumbrance against such tract of real property in the office of the county clerk of Curry County, New Mexico. Such lien, when filed and recorded, shall constitute a first and paramount lien against such tract of real property, subject only to the priority of the general property tax.
